Fix Anything With A Data Recovery ToolA data recovery tool is a piece of software or hardware that helps you recover data that is lost from your computer for any number of reasons. There are many recovery tools on the marketplace, most of which are easy to use and come with a simple interface that will allow you to use the tool to locate your lost files and recover the files that you once thought were deleted forever.
